Visa launches a new mobile payment service in Ghana.

Visa has launched a mobile payment service in Ghana which will help individuals access their products without stress.

Visa on mobile

Four banks, CAL Bank, Ecobank, GTBank and Zenith Bank all in Ghana have partnered with Visa to unravel the new product.

The banks have either enabled Visa on mobile on their mobile banking applications and, or have acquired merchants to be able to accept the service.

CAL Bank, and Zenith Bank customers will access the service via their banking application. Ecobank customers have the USSD and banking application option while GTBank customers will access via USSD.

Merchants aggregated through Expresspay will also accept Visa on mobile

Visa, in an announcement on Friday November 23, 2018, disclosed that, the visa on mobile money is an easy and secure payments solution for Ghanaian customers.

“It allows customers to directly access funds in their bank accounts to pay merchants (person-to-merchant or P2M) or individuals (person-to-person or P2P). The payment goes straight from the consumer’s bank account into the merchant’s account and provides real-time notification to both parties at no cost,” the company said.
